RTS Stock Exchange Classic Market: Year 2004 Results
Date 24/01/2005
Over the year 2004 the RTS Index increased by 8.3% and closed on December 31st, 2004, at 614.11. The minimum value of the index last year equaled 518.15 (July 27th), the maximum – 781.6 (April 12th).

RTS Order-Driven Market: 2004 Results
Date 24/01/2005
In 2004 total trading volume on the RTS Group Order-driven market reached the record 609 billion rubles, the 2.7 times increase on the year. The "Gazprom" stock market showed the best dynamics, with total turnover increasing threefold, to 577 billion rubles. Market participants also became more active: if in 2003 326 thousand trades were executed, in 2004 this number increased to 628 thousand.

RTS Board: Year 2004 Results
Date 24/01/2005
In 2004 the total trading volume on the RTS Board increased by 140%, from 72 million dollars in 2003 to 173 million US dollars. Traders activities increased more than twofold – from 2 583 to 6 014 trades.
